Mark joined the Army having read English Literature at Exeter and on exchange in Berkeley, California. His choice of regiment - the Gurkhas – led him to Nepal where he forged a strong link with most things Himalaya.
Mark returned to Nepal many times post-Army, working in earthquake response, rural development and as a trekking and photography guide. Closer to home, Mark has loved working summer seasons in Swiss, French, Italian, Austrian and Bavarian alps, guiding both trekking and running tours.
Mark now lives in the Lake District where he enjoys planting trees, running fells, cold water swims and strong, piping-hot, black coffee. He is also a medic in a Mountain Rescue Team and recently wrangled his first crag-fast sheep back to safety.
This is Mark’s first season in Greenland and he is super excited about the challenges and adventures that lie ahead.
